5. The Number Devil by Hans Magnus Enzensberger

This book follows a boy named Robert who has 12 dreams about a number devil, who teaches him math. This book is very creative and educational, and also fun to read. If you want to see the rest, read this book!
4. No Talking by Andrew Clements

This book is about enemies in the 5th grade and a 2-day silence contest. This book is quite funny and a page-turner, and like the rest of Clements’ books, very creative. Want to see more? Read this book!
3. Where the Sidewalk Ends by Shel Silverstein

This book is a compilation of Shel Silverstein’s best poems. This book is full of ridiculous poems that will make you laugh, and also very innovative. If you want funny poems, then this is the book for you!
2. Frindle by Andrew Clements
This book is about a kid named Nick who wants to create a new word. This book is inspirational, funny, and original all in one. Does Nick’s new word come to pass? Read Frindle to find out.
1. Fudge-a-mania by Judy Blume

This book is about the misadventures of the Hatcher family during their trip to Maine. This book is extremely funny and will keep you laughing the whole time. It is also a page-turner, because you will want to keep reading! Do you want a funny book? If so, you should read Fudge-a-mania!
